I can confidently say that 'Cobra 2' hasn’t been adapted into a movie yet. The book, written by Tom Clancy and Tony Zinni, is a gripping military analysis of the Iraq War, and its dense, fact-driven narrative might not easily translate to the big screen. While Clancy’s other works like 'The Hunt for Red October' and 'Clear and Present Danger' have been successfully adapted, 'Cobra 2' remains untouched by Hollywood.

I’ve scoured film databases and fan forums, and there’s no movie adaptation of 'Cobra 2' as of now. The book’s focus on real-world military strategy and its lack of a traditional narrative arc might make it a tough sell for studios. However, if you’re craving something similar, '13 Hours' is a fantastic action-packed film based on real events, and it shares the same gritty, boots-on-the-ground vibe. 'Black Hawk Down' is another excellent choice, with its intense portrayal of modern combat.
